What is 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der characterized by persistent patterns of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. While ADHD is frequently identified in youth, about 60% of those diagnosed will carry these symptoms into the adult years. Acknowledging these symptoms in adults is vital for efficient management and improving lifestyle.

Inattention: [Adults with ADHD](http://45.192.105.100:3000/add-in-adults3273) might often struggle to follow through on tasks or may find it hard to organize their obligations. This can manifest as persistent disorganization at work, missed out on due dates, or forgetting appointments.

Hyperactivity: While hyperactivity might be less noticeable in adults than in kids, it can still manifest as sensations of uneasyness or an inability to take part in quiet activities. Adults may feel constantly 'on the go' or have problem unwinding.

Impulsivity: Impulsive habits in adults can result in rash choices in monetary matters, relationships, or other life choices. Adults might battle with self-control, often regretting their choices afterward.
Impact of ADHD Symptoms on Daily Life
The [symptoms of ADHD](https://git.hubhoo.com/adult-adhd-symptoms4281) can substantially affect different elements of an adult's life, including:

Work Performance: Inattention and poor organization can cause missed due dates, bad task performance, and challenges in preserving a professional relationship.

Relationships: Impulsivity and restlessness can trigger pressure in individual relationships. Adults with ADHD might unintentionally interrupt discussions or neglect responsibilities in the house.

Self-confidence: The difficulties of managing day-to-day tasks can lead to sensations of inadequacy, aggravation, and low self-confidence. Adults with untreated ADHD typically experience high levels of anxiety and anxiety.

A: ADHD is normally considered a developmental disorder that emerges in youth. However, it can be detected in adults who were never ever determined as children. Symptoms can become more noticable throughout difficult life modifications.
Q2: How is ADHD diagnosed in adults?
A: Diagnosis usually includes an extensive examination by a psychological health expert, consisting of scientific interviews, self-reports, and habits evaluations. A history of symptoms going back to childhood is frequently needed.

Q4: Can ADHD symptoms worsen with age?
A: Some adults might experience aggravating symptoms of ADHD as they age, specifically if they face increased obligations. Others may establish better coping strategies with time, leading to enhanced management of symptoms.
